Explore the New Royal Caribbean Star of the Seas: The Future of Cruises

Royal Caribbean Star of the Seas arrives as crowd welcomes ship.

Star of the Seas Sets Sail: A New Era for Royal Caribbean

The much-anticipated Star of the Seas has officially commenced its inaugural voyage, marking a transformative chapter in Royal Caribbean's fleet. As the second ship of the innovative Icon class, this colossal vessel, weighing in at 250,800 tons, embarked on its first revenue cruise from Port Canaveral on August 16, 2025. Delivered in early July from the Meyer Turku shipyard, the ship is poised to redefine luxury cruising.

The Thrill of New Destinations

Travel enthusiasts can rejoice as the Star of the Seas introduces a series of enticing short cruises to the breathtaking Bahamas. Among these escapades is Royal Caribbean's private island, Perfect Day at CocoCay. Initially, guests will experience three- and four-night preview cruises, with the ship officially named during a ceremony on August 20, 2025 by astronaut Kellie Gerardi. The ship was originally set to have iconic singer Diana Ross as its godmother, but she stepped down from the role, preserving her status in the entertainment world while allowing the cruise to continue its celebratory launch.

A Grand Maiden Voyage Awaits

On August 31, 2025, the Star of the Seas will embark on its maiden seven-night cruise to the Western Caribbean, featuring stops at popular destinations such as Cozumel, Costa Maya, and Roatán. The grand itinerary also includes visits to the Eastern Caribbean, ensuring a dazzling array of experiences for its 5,310 guests, all returning to the home port in Central Florida. Anticipation continues to build as fans of cruising mark their calendars for the ship’s multitude of voyages going through April 2027.

Icon Class: The Future of Cruising

Royal Caribbean's Icon class not only boasts the Star of the Seas but also the Icon of the Seas, which launched in 2023, and the upcoming Legend of the Seas, arriving in 2026. A fourth sibling is also on the horizon, adding to the vibrant future ahead for the cruise line.

Government Shutdown: Carnival Cruise Lines Offers Assurance for Travelers

Update Understanding the Impact of the Government Shutdown on Cruise Lines As the U.S. government faces a shutdown due to funding disputes, concerns about its effects on various sectors arise. However, for travelers and cruise enthusiasts, recent insights from Carnival Cruise Line's Brand Ambassador, John Heald, provide reassurance. According to Heald, "The government shutdown does not have a direct impact on cruise ship operations." This news is particularly vital for passengers aboard ships such as the Carnival Spirit and Carnival Legend, which are currently servicing cruises to Hawaii. What Remains Operational? While many federal employees are impacted, essential services will keep functioning normally, especially for key roles that support the cruise industry. TSA agents and Customs and Border Protection officers are classified as essential workers, ensuring that security and port operations continue uninterrupted during the shutdown. This was echoed in a recent report by Cruise Hive, which noted that crucial functions at cruise ports would remain operational, albeit with a possibility of delays as many essential staff work without pay. Excursions and Services: What to Expect? While cruise operations remain largely unaffected, some effects may trickle down to excursions. Travelers booked on cruises to locations with federally operated attractions, such as national parks, should prepare for potential cancellations or alterations to planned excursions. Heald mentioned that Carnival had proactively communicated with guests regarding possible interruptions, stating, "We did send notices to the people involved, and we’ll take care of them." This shows the cruise line's commitment to ensuring passenger satisfaction amid potential disruptions. Long-Term Perspectives: The Future of the Cruise Industry During Uncertainty The uncertainty of government operations prompts a broader conversation about how such shutdowns can affect tourism. According to estimates by the U.S. Travel Association, the travel sector could see losses upwards of $1 billion per week during prolonged shutdowns. Comparatively, while the cruise industry might initially seem less affected, the long-term repercussions could be significant, especially if airports experience delays and other sectors face disruptions that ripple into travel expenses and availability. Practical Tips for Travelers For those planning to travel during this time, there are essential strategies to mitigate potential disruptions. Always plan to arrive at your port city earlier than scheduled to allow time for possible delays. Monitor updates from cruise lines and be flexible with your travel arrangements. It might also be beneficial to have contingencies in mind for excursions, especially those that depend on federally operated services. Additionally, travelers should consider checking in with cruise lines for specific guidance on ports, excursions, and other pertinent updates.
